WebBackground: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) has been well established as an effective treatment for post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). However, PTSD has been re-categorized as part of trauma and stressor-related disorders instead of anxiety disorders. We conducted the first meta-analysis on Randomized Controlled …

WebGeneralized anxiety disorder is the most common form of anxiety. This condition causes excessive worry over everyday events. These feelings are oftentimes disproportionate to the situation at hand and can become uncontrollable. These thoughts and feelings can make it difficult for a person to concentrate.
